The state-of-the-art venue in Helsingborg (Photo: courtesy of Max Ansbro) by Ian Marshall, ITTF Publications Editor Travel plans being finalised, over 2,000 players will descend on the Swedish city of Helsingborg for the 2017 European Veteran Championships; furthermore, a notable number will be from the host nation, more the 340 Swedes have registered for the week-long event. Play commences on Monday 26th June and concludes on Saturday 1st July. It will be a hectic week; some no doubt still making last minute travel plans; however there is no doubt the Helsingborg is ready.
